Implement these six responsive fixes in sequence: 1) set a proper viewport and use mobile-first CSS; 2) implement responsive images with srcset and modern formats; 3) defer non-critical JavaScript and inline critical CSS; 4) optimize server response with caching and CDN; 5) simplify navigation and CTAs for narrow screens; 6) eliminate layout shifts by reserving image and ad dimensions. After each change, validate with lab and field metrics and A/B test where possible.

Why Is Mobile Rendering and Indexing Critical?
Mobile-first rendering remains a baseline requirement, as search engines primarily use mobile crawlers for indexing and assessment. Ensuring responsive design, server-side rendering for JavaScript-heavy apps, and proper viewport configuration prevents content from being invisible to crawlers.
Which tools are essential for maintaining site health?
Essential tools include Google Search Console, Lighthouse, Screaming Frog, log-file analyzers, and a robust CDN. For enterprise sites, integrate DeepCrawl, OnCrawl, and Datadog to correlate SEO signals with server telemetry.
Why is image optimization crucial?
Optimized, responsive images reduce payload and improve perceived speed, which lowers abandonment. Techniques include srcset, sizes, WebP/AVIF formats, and lazy loading to defer offscreen images until needed.
